The show begins and our commentary team of Excalibur, Taz, Ricky Starks and Chris Jericho welcome us to tonight's show, our two competitors for our opening contest of the evening are already in the ring and it's time for an Owen Hart Foundation Tournament qualifier!

Swerve Strickland vs. Darby Allin (with Sting) — Owen Hart Foundation Tournament Qualifier

Swerve with a takedown to start. Darby sends Swerve to the corner, Swerve tries to kick his way out but Darby sends him to the mat. Darby with an arm-drag, Swerve locks-in a head-lock and shoves Darby out of the ring, Swerve follows him out but walks into a stunner, Darby tosses Swerve back into the ring and goes for the cover but Swerve kicks out. Swerve rolls back to the outside, Darby dives through the ropes and to the outside but Swerve drills him with a knee and we head to a commercial break. Back from the break and Swerve gets to the apron and suplexes Darby over the top rope and they both spill to the floor near the entrance ramp. Swerve gets Darby back into the ring, Ricky Starks leaves the commentary table and comes down but Sting blocks him from getting to the ring and Starks heads back to commentary. Back in the ring, Swerve lines Darby up but Darby slides out and plants Swerve with Last Supper for the 1-2-3!

Winner - Darby Allin (Qualifies For Owen Hart Foundation Tournament)

Jade Cargill, Kiera Hogan & Red Velvet (with Mark Sterling) vs. Willow Nightingale, Trish Adora & Skye Blue

Cargill and Skye start this one off. Cargill backs off and makes a tag to Red, who cheap shots Willow off the apron and slams Skye to the mat. Red lands a few stomps on Skye and tosses her to the corner before making the tag to Kiera, who drills Skye with a drop-kick. Kiera misses a leg-drop, Willow comes in and clocks Red out of the ring and Skye makes the tag to Trish. Kiera trips Trish to the mat and makes the tag to Cargill, who blasts Trish with a pump kick then plants her with Jaded for the three-count!

Winners - Jade Cargill, Kiera Hogan & Red Velvet

Keith Lee vs. Colten Gunn (with Austin Gunn)

Lee launches Gunn across the ring and to the corner to start. Gunn comes back with some strikes to the back and sends Lee to the corner but Lee chops Gunn in the chest, Gunn rolls to the outside and we head to a commercial break. Back from the break and Lee sends Gunn to the corner, Gunn slides out of the way of a corner splash and goes for the Famouser but Lee evaded and plants Gunn with the Big Bang Catastrophe for the 1-2-3!

Winner - Keith Lee

We then cut back to the ring where Ring Of Honor's Ian Riccaboni joins commentary for this one and ROH's ring announcer Bobby Cruise makes the introductions and it's time for our main event of the evening.

Samoa Joe (C) vs. Trent Beretta — Ring Of Honor World Television Championship

Joe and Trent observe the Code Of Honor before the bell rings and they shake hands. A test-of-strength starts this one off. Joe lights up Trent with some chops to the chest, Trent goes for a tornado DDT and Joe hits a big boot and we head to a commercial break. Back from the break and Joe’s working over Trent in the center of the ring. Trent flips out of a submission, Joe slides out of the ring, goes up top and dives onto Joe with a cross-body to the outside. A brawl ensues, Joe tosses Trent back into the ring and lands a suplex. Trent lifts Joe but Joe slides out and plants him with a power-bomb. Joe lights Trent up with a strike combination and then locks-in a cross-face but Trent scoots himself to the ropes and grabs the bottom rope to force a break. Joe drills Trent with some strikes and sends him to the corner and lifts Trent for the Muscle Buster but Trent slides out and Joe rolls Trent back for a cover but Trent kicks out at two. Trent rushes at Joe but Joe plants him with a uranage then locks-in the Kokina Clutch and Trent’s shoulders stay on the mat long enough for the three-count!

Winner - Samoa Joe (C) (STILL Ring Of Honor World Television Champion)

After the match, Joe and Trent shake hands and Tony Schiavone comes into the ring to talk with the champion. Jay Lethal, Sonjay Dutt and Satnam Singh immediately interrupt and as they rush the ring, Chuck Taylor and Orange Cassidy cut them off and a brawl ensues and it continues as the show goes off-the-air.​​​​​​​
